El municipio de la Palma, Cundinamarca tiene como base de su economía la agricultura y la ganadería, en el cual el cultivo de café es motor de su desarrollo. La Asociación de Caficultores de la Palma “ASOPARIBARI” organizó a familias de la zona, para buscar la mejora de los procesos de organización comunitaria, productividad y sostenibilidad cafetera. Por otro lado, la Federación Nacional de Cafeteros de Colombia impulsa proyectos para la construcción de centrales de beneficio del café para mejorar la calidad del grano y el manejo de subproductos.

This article describes the foreign and domestic approaches to the assessment of agricultural and agro-industrial innovations. The cost behavior analysis in case of agro-industrial technological innovations has been conducted and the efficiency of the growth in high tech production and manufacture has been evaluated. A paradoxical regularity has been revealed: with the relatively stable investments in agriculture there is a sharp reduction in the use of intellectual property. This tendency dictates the need to improve the management system of the intellectual property application.
The review describes the diversity of innovation and relates it to agro-food sector. It also sheds light on different innovation models and explores their contribution to framing agro-food sustainability transitions. There are many variations in the use of the term ‘innovation’. Typical distinctions encountered in the literature are incremental vs. radical innovation and product vs. process vs. organizational innovation. A significant feature of the development of modern innovation thinking has been a gradual broadening of innovation scope as well as more attention to sustainability.

This paper draws on data collected during 12 months of fieldwork in Northern Ghana. The fieldwork researched two communities in two districts of Northern Ghana and three Agricultural Development Agencies (ADA); Savanna Agricultural Research Institute (SARI), the Ministry of Food and Agriculture (MOFA) and World Vision Ghana (WVG). Data collection was achieved through formal surveys, Focus Group Discussions (FGDs) and observations. A total of 120 individual interviews were conducted for the formal survey guided by the questionnaire.
